人脐带间充质干细胞对小鼠肝缺血-再灌注损伤后肝内CD4+T细胞的影响

Effect of human umbilical cord mesenchymal stem cells on CD4+ T cells in liver after hepatic ischemia-reperfusion injury in mice

  • 摘要:
      目的  探讨人脐带间充质干细胞(HUC-MSCs)对小鼠肝缺血-再灌注损伤(HIRI)后肝内CD4+T细胞的影响。
      方法  将225只小鼠随机分为sham组、control组和MSC组,每组75只。其中MSC组和control组均为HIRI模型小鼠,MSC组通过下腔静脉注射HUC-MSCs,control组通过下腔静脉注射生理盐水,sham组仅进行开腹、关腹等操作,不行血管夹闭。分别于术后6、12、24 h,每组随机取15只小鼠,用于眼球取血法采血及取肝组织样本,每组剩下的30只小鼠用于肝内单核细胞的提取。比较各组小鼠不同时间点肝内单核细胞数量,CD4+T细胞比例、数量和阳性率;比较各组小鼠不同时间点血清和肝组织中白细胞介素(IL)-17含量,及肝组织内共刺激分子B7-1和B7-2信使核糖核酸(mRNA)表达水平。
      结果  术后12、24 h,control组的肝内单核细胞数量明显高于sham组,而MSC组的肝内单核细胞数量明显低于control组(P < 0.01~0.05)。术后6、12、24 h,control组的CD4+T细胞比例、数量及阳性率均明显高于sham组(均为P < 0.01),MSC组的CD4+T细胞比例明显低于control组(P < 0.01~0.05);术后12、24 h,MSC组的CD4+T细胞数量和阳性率均明显低于control组(P < 0.01~0.05)。术后6、12、24 h,control组血清和肝组织中的IL-17含量均高于sham组(均为P < 0.01),而MSC组血清和肝组织中的IL-17含量均低于control组(均为P < 0.01)。术后6 h,control组B7-2的mRNA表达水平高于sham组(P < 0.05);术后12、24 h,control组B7-1和B7-2的mRNA表达水平均高于sham组(均为P < 0.01),而MSC组B7-1和B7-2的mRNA表达水平均低于control组(均为P < 0.01)。
      结论  HUC-MSCs抑制HIRI后肝内CD4+T细胞的数量和IL-17的分泌,同时减少肝内单核细胞数量及B7-1和B7-2 mRNA表达,减轻HIRI。

     

    Abstract:
      Objective  To investigate the effect of human umbilical cord mesenchymal stem cells (HUC-MSCs) on CD4+ T cells in liver after hepatic ischemia-reperfusion injury (HIRI) in mice.
      Methods  Two hundred and twentyfive mice were randomly divided into sham group, control group and MSC group, with 75 mice in each group. HIRI model mice were used in MSC group and control group. HUC-MSCs were injected in MSC group through inferior vena cava. Normal saline was injected in control group through inferior vena cava. Only laparotomy and abdominal closure were performed in sham group without blood vessel clipping. At 6, 12 and 24 h after operation, 15 mice of each group were randomly selected to sample eyeball blood and liver tissues, and the 30 mice left in each group were used to extract intrahepatic mononuclear cells. The number of intrahepatic mononuclear cells, percentage, number and positive rate of CD4+ T cells in the mice of various groups at different time points were compared. The content of interleukin (IL)-17 in serum and liver tissue as well as expression levels of costimulatory molecules B7-1 and B7-2 messenger RNA (mRNA) in liver tissues of the mice at different time points were compared.
      Results  At 12 and 24 h after operation, the number of intrahepatic mononuclear cells of control group was significantly higher than that of sham group, while the number of intrahepatic mononuclear cells of MSC group was significantly lower than that of control group (P < 0.01-0.05). At 6, 12 and 24 h after operation, the percentage, number and positive rate of CD4+T cells of control group were significantly higher than those of sham group (all P < 0.01), while the percentage of CD4+T cells of MSC group was significantly lower than that of control group (P < 0.01-0.05). At 12 and 24 h after operation, the number and positive rate of CD4+ T cells of MSC group were significantly lower than those of control group (P < 0.01-0.05). At 6, 12 and 24 h after operation, the IL-17 contents in serum and liver tissues of control group were higher than those of sham group (all P < 0.01), while the IL-17 contents in serum and liver tissues of MSC group were lower than those of control group (all P < 0.01). At 6 h after operation, the mRNA expression level of B7-2 of control group was higher than that of sham group (P < 0.05). At 12 and 24 h after operation, the mRNA expression levels of B7-1 and B7-2 of control group were higher than those of sham group (all P < 0.01), while the mRNA expression levels of B7-1 and B7-2 of MSC group were lower than those of control group (all P < 0.01).
      Conclusions  HUC-MSCs inhibits the number of CD4+T cells and the secretion of IL-17 in liver after HIRI, as well as decreases the number of intrahepatic mononuclear cells and the mRNA expression of B7-1 and B7-2, thereby alleviating HIRI.
